There were 9.7k property sales in Suffolk county in the previous twelve months and sales dropped by 10.3% (-1.2k transactions). 560 properties, 5.8% were sales of a newly built property. Most properties were sold in the £300k-£400k price range with 2061 (21.2%) properties sold, followed by £200k-£250k price range with 1876 (19.3%) properties sold.



| Property price range | Market share | Sales volume |
|---|---|---|
| under £50k | 0.1% | 7 |
| £50k-£100k | 1.9% | 181 |
| £100k-£150k | 6.4% | 622 |
| £150k-£200k | 12.8% | 1.2k |
| £200k-£250k | 19.3% | 1.9k |
| £250k-£300k | 17.2% | 1.7k |
| £300k-£400k | 21.2% | 2.1k |
| £400k-£500k | 10.6% | 1.0k |
| £500k-£750k | 7.8% | 760 |
| £750k-£1M | 2.0% | 193 |
| over £1M | 0.7% | 66 |
